@ -71,6 +71,7 @@ The current set of network parameters:
:maxMessageSize: Maximum allowed size in bytes of an individual message sent over the wire. Note that attachments are
a special case and may be fragmented for streaming transfer, however, an individual transaction or flow message
may not be larger than this value.
:maxTransactionSize: Maximum allowed size in bytes of a transaction. This is the size of the transaction object and its attachments.
:modifiedTime: The time when the network parameters were last modified by the compatibility zone operator.
:epoch: Version number of the network parameters. Starting from 1, this will always increment whenever any of the
parameters change.
